One of Richard's latest patents is focused on a fence wall section. Additionally, he developed a refresh system for digital signals. In a DPCM video digital data communication system, each scan line of a video frame is refreshed with PCM data over a refresh cycle comprising a plurality of frames. Refresh generators at the transmitter and receiver are synchronized with an initialization signal and then run asynchronously to select scan lines for refresh. The refresh generators each employ counters for counting a selected number M, which has no factors in common with the number of scan lines of a frame, to select scan lines for refresh that have respectively different spatial positions in adjacent frames to avoid generating visible refresh artifacts. The number of frames in a refresh cycle is adaptively changed to stabilize the fill of the transmitter rate buffer.

Throughout his career, Richard has worked with prominent companies such as General Electric Company and RCA Inc. His experience in these organizations has allowed him to refine his skills and contribute to groundbreaking innovations in technology.
Collaborations
Richard has collaborated with notable individuals in his field, including Alfonse Anthony Acampora and Nicola J Fedele. These partnerships have fostered an environment of creativity and innovation, leading to advancements in digital communication.
